Java x UML

4 respostas
Renan_Narciso

Galera, estou com dúvida em transformar isso em Java quando o relacionamento é unidirecional, gostaria de um help, fiz desse jeito. Está correto?

public class Curso {

	private String nome;
	private Professor[] listaProfessor;
	private Professor coordenador;

}

public class Professor {
	
	private String nome;
	private Curso c;
	
}

4 Respostas

igomes

Curso tem professores
Professor tem um curso
Unidirecional ?

esmiralha

Está correto, sim. Mas eu não usaria um array de Professor e sim uma lista.

esmiralha

A relação unidirecional é entre o curso e o coordenador.

Renan_Narciso

valeu!!

Criado 3 de setembro de 2016
Ultima resposta 12 de out. de 2016
Respostas 4
Participantes 3